    (This podcast was previously published on January 5, 2021) Jesus Ministries, Joan Boney ... When did the New Testament church begin? How did the church become established? There was no New Testament church when Jesus walked on this earth in the form of a man. There was only the synagogue of the Jews. As HE lived on this earth, Jesus appointed 12 apostles to be His disciples, including Judas who betrayed HIM. After Jesus was resurrected, the 11 apostles selected 2 men over which they drew lots to see who would replace Judas. Acts 1:26 And they gave forth their lots; and the lot fell upon Matthias; and he was numbered with the eleven apostles. (So Matthias became the 12th apostle.) As this was happening, Paul (Saul) was busy persecuting the followers of Jesus. From heaven Jesus called Paul and spoke to Paul making Paul an apostle. Paul tells us this story in Acts 26 as he testified before king Agrippa. Acts 26:9-19 I verily thought with myself, that I ought to do many things contrary to the name of Jesus of Nazareth. Which thing I also did in Jerusalem: and many of the saints did I shut up in prison, having received authority from the chief priests; and when they were put to death, I gave my voice against them. And I punished them oft in every synagogue, and compelled them to blaspheme; and being exceedingly mad against them, I persecuted them even unto strange cities. 12 Whereupon as I went to Damascus with authority and commission from the chief priests, 13 At midday, O king, I saw in the way a light from heaven, above the brightness of the sun, shining round about me and them which journeyed with me. 14 And when we were all fallen to the earth, I heard a voice speaking unto me, and saying in the Hebrew tongue, Saul, Saul, why persecutest thou me? it is hard for thee to kick against the pricks. And I said, Who art thou, Lord? And he said, I am Jesus whom thou persecutest. 16 But rise, and stand upon thy feet: for I have appeared unto thee for this purpose, to make thee a minister and a witness both of these things which thou hast seen, and of those things in the which I will appear unto thee; 17 Delivering thee from the people, and from the Gentiles, unto whom now I send thee, 18 To open their eyes, and to turn them from darkness to light, and from the power of Satan unto God, that they may receive forgiveness of sins, and inheritance among them which are sanctified by faith that is in ME. 19 Whereupon, O king Agrippa, I was not disobedient unto the heavenly vision: So where does Paul fit in the church? They already have 12 apostles.
